About Andrea Sgarro

Andrea Sgarro is a scholar working on Computational Theory and Mathematics, Artificial Intelligence and Discrete Mathematics and Combinatorics, having authored 37 papers that have together received 305 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Wireless Communication Security Techniques (7 papers), Algorithms and Data Compression (7 papers) and Computability, Logic, AI Algorithms (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computational Theory and Mathematics (95 citations), Artificial Intelligence (150 citations) and Computer Networks and Communications (88 citations). Andrea Sgarro has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, Romania and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include G. Longo, János Körner, L. Davisson, Liviu P. Dinu, Rolf Johannesson, Luca Bortolussi, Giuseppe Longobardi, Cristina Guardiano, Flaminia L. Luccio and Alessandro Tossi.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Information Theory, Philosophical Transactions of the Royal Society B Biological Sciences and Fuzzy Sets and Systems.
